Easy to maintain

The French Bulldog, or "Frenchies" as they are affectionately known has become one of the most common breeds of dogs over the last few years. Their good-natured temperament and charming appearance make them ideal companions for people of all age groups. Like any breed they require special care to stay healthy and happy. These dogs need regular exercise to ensure their muscles are strong and healthy, as well as regular grooming and dental care. Fortunately, these pups are easy to take care of and love being the center of attention.

They're perfect for apartment pets since they don't require lots of space and enjoy spending time on the couch with their family. They're generally good with children and other animals however, they must be introduced to children carefully to avoid accidental injuries. In addition, they might not be able to handle rough play, especially from larger, more rambunctious dogs. Their brachycephalic design indicates that they are not great swimmers and should be kept indoors close to water bodies.

They also need to be aware of their skin folds. If they are not kept clean, a condition referred to as skin fold dermatitis can develop. In addition to keeping up with their coats, Frenchies need regular nail trimmings and dental treatment. Brushing their teeth every day and visiting the vet when necessary can help prevent gum disease. They're also more likely suffer from ear infections as compared to other breeds, so making sure they're clean and checking for symptoms of ear infections regularly is essential.

Frenchies are also a breed that is prone to put on weight easily It is therefore important to keep track of their diet and take them on short walks to avoid overtraining. Additionally, it is important to avoid hot weather as much as you can since they may overheat easily. Consult your veterinarian if you detect any signs that your French Bulldog is overheating.

Good with kids

Frenchies are playful and affectionate dogs, which makes them a good fit for children. Their small size makes them less scary for children, and they often enjoy hanging out with their families and cuddling up on the couch to watch a film or a Saturday morning cartoon. This closeness to their parents gives them a sense of security and makes them feel safer.

Like any dog, it is important to socialize your dog with children at a young age to ensure that they feel at ease with them. It's a good idea to train them using positive reinforcement and teach them the basic commands. This will help you child develop a relationship of trust and love with their dog.

Low-maintenance

French Bulldogs require minimal exercise and grooming. They are content indoors, and they enjoy being lap dogs. These dogs are playful and can amuse their owners and delight them by clowning around. But, they are also content to just sit and relax. They aren't inclined to excessive barking and they are not often aggressive.

They are social and can be found with other dogs, children, and cats. Although they may be cautious with strangers, most Frenchies are friendly and warm to visitors in the house. They can live with other pets living in the house but they aren't a good choice for a home that has small animals due to their size and their strong instincts to safeguard their food and possessions. They don't take temperatures well so it is best to keep them in the shade in the summer heat.

Like other breeds with short faces, Frenchies can suffer from back problems, including intervertebral disc disease. To avoid this, do not over-exercise them or leave them outside for extended periods of time. They are also not great swimmers and should be kept away from swimming pools and ponds. They may also develop a condition referred to as entropion in which their eyes roll inward, irritating their corneas. This hereditary disorder can cause blindness but can be corrected with surgery.
